光网络中保证传输质量的选路与波长分配算法研究和实现的综述报告.docx
上传人:快乐****蜜蜂 上传时间:2024-09-14 格式:DOCX 页数:3 大小:11KB 金币:5 举报 版权申诉
预览加载中,请您耐心等待几秒...

光网络中保证传输质量的选路与波长分配算法研究和实现的综述报告.docx

光网络中保证传输质量的选路与波长分配算法研究和实现的综述报告.docx

预览

在线预览结束,喜欢就下载吧,查找使用更方便

5 金币

下载此文档

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

光网络中保证传输质量的选路与波长分配算法研究和实现的综述报告随着现代通信技术的发展,光网络(OpticalNetwork)作为一种高速、容量大、低功耗、波长多路复用的新型通信方式,逐渐成为了信息高速传输的主流。实现高速光网络传输的关键在于保证传输质量,而选路与波长分配算法是实现传输质量保证的重要手段。本篇综述报告将从选路和波长分配两个方面,对光网络中保证传输质量的选路与波长分配算法进行探讨。一、选路算法选路算法是指在光网络中确定光路的路径,使得数据能够以最优的方式进行传输。选路算法的主要目的是通过对网络拓扑结构和网络流量特征的综合分析,找到一条最优路径,实现光网络的高效、可靠和稳定的数据传输。目前常用的选路算法主要有以下几种:1、最短路径算法最短路径算法是最为直接和简单的选路算法,它可以通过计算两个节点之间的最短距离来确定最优路径。最短路径算法有多种实现方式,如Dijkstra算法、Bellman-Ford算法和Floyd算法等。这些算法都基于图的理论,可以根据不同的需求和网络规模进行选择。2、负载均衡算法负载均衡算法是为了优化网络资源的使用而产生的一种选路算法。负载均衡算法可以根据不同节点的负载情况选择最优路径,以达到负载均衡的目的。常见的负载均衡算法有Least-Loaded和Power-Random等。3、混合算法混合算法是指将最短路径算法和负载均衡算法相结合,以优化网络性能的一种算法。它可以根据负载情况动态地调整网络拓扑结构和路径选择。这种算法可以优化网络资源的使用,提高传输效率。常见的混合算法有Dijkstra-LB和Bellman-Ford-LB等。二、波长分配算法波长分配算法是指在光网络中为不同的请求分配不同的波长,以实现光网络的高效、可靠和稳定的传输。波长分配算法通过选择合适的波长,来提高光网络的可靠性、带宽利用率和传输性能。目前比较常见的波长分配算法有以下几种:1、固定波长分配算法固定波长分配算法是一种简单、易于实现但效率受限的波长分配算法。该算法将波长按顺序分配给请求,但由于不同请求将对应同样的波长,因此会出现波长冲突的情况。固定波长分配算法在小型光网络中有一定的用途,但在大型光网络中会出现不少问题。2、动态波长分配算法动态波长分配算法可以在不同的请求之间动态地分配波长,避免了固定分配算法的问题。动态波长分配算法可以根据网络负载情况,分析出适合的波长进行分配。常见的动态波长分配算法有First-Fit、Next-Fit、Best-Fit、Worst-Fit等。3、混合波长分配算法混合波长分配算法是将固定波长分配和动态波长分配相结合的一种波长分配算法。利用混合波长分配算法,可以优化网络资源的使用,提高传输效率。常见的混合波长分配算法有预调度算法和基于负载均衡策略的波长分配算法。结语:本篇综述报告从选路和波长分配两个方面,对光网络中保证传输质量的选路与波长分配算法进行了探讨。选路算法可以根据不同的网络需求和规模进行选择,通过动态调整网络拓扑结构和路径选择,优化网络性能。波长分配算法可以利用动态波长分配、负载均衡等策略,提高光网络传输的可靠性和灵活性,提高波长利用率,优化网络性能。本篇综述旨在帮助读者了解光网络的选路和波长分配算法,从而加深对光网络通信技术的理解和认识。